STUDIES OF URONIC ACID MATERIALS, Part 58: GUM EXUDATES FROM THE GENUSSTERCULIA(GUM KARAYA)

Abstract
Analytical data are presented for the gum exudates from Sterculia urens (2 specimens), Sterculia villosa (2 specimens), Sterculia setigera (4 specimens), and a commercial sample of gum karaya used recently in toxicological studies. The exudates from these Sterculia spp. are very similar in composition and physico-chemical properties; some data of significance in toxicological studies are presented. There is considerable scope for the development of Sterculia setigera as a tree crop in Africa.
